Renee Reuter is an American attorney and politician currently serving as a member of the Missouri House of Representatives. Representing the 112th House district, she is affiliated with the Republican Party. In addition to her role in the state legislature, Reuter is preparing to run for the 22nd district of the Missouri State Senate in the upcoming 2026 elections. Early life and career

Renee Reuter was educated at Colorado College, where she completed her undergraduate studies. Following her time at Colorado College, Reuter pursued a legal education at St. Louis University School of Law, where she earned her Juris Doctor degree.
